Subject: [PATCH 8/8] wifi: ath11k: add support for MHI bandwidth scaling

From: Miaoqing Pan <quic_miaoqing@...cinc.com>

Add support for MHI bandwidth scaling, which will reduce power consumption
if WLAN operates with lower bandwidth. This feature is only enabled for
QCA6390.
